500 Disney information technology workers laid off?

teamdisney

WESH.com reports that “about 500 information technology workers at Disney” were laid off on Friday, January 30. Many of these cast members helped in the development of MyMagic+ and MagicBands. Many Disney IT jobs have been outsourced internationally since 2012, when India-based HCL took over Disney’s IT contract.

Jacquee Wahler, Disney spokeswoman, said, “We are restructuring our global technology organization to support future innovation and new capabilities and will work with leading technical firms to maintain our existing systems.” She also said that there were not 500 layoffs, but didn’t give an exact number. مواقع مراهنات كرة قدم
